def set(self, state: bool) -> None:
"""
``TRACe:IQ:APCon[:STATe]`` \n
Snippet: ``driver.trace.iq.apcon.state.set(state = False)`` \n
If enabled, the average power consumption is calculated at the end of the I/Q data measurement. This command must be set
before the measurement is performed! The conversion factors A and B for the calculation are defined using method
``RsFsw.trace.iq.apcon.a.set()`` and method ``RsFsw.trace.iq.apcon.b.set()`` . The results can be queried using method
``RsFsw.trace.iq.apcon.result.get()`` . For details see 'Average power consumption'.
:param state: ON | OFF | 0 | 1 OFF | 0 Switches the function off ON | 1 Switches the function on
"""
param = Conversions.bool_to_str(state)
self._core.io.write(f'TRACe:IQ:APCon:STATe {param}')
